Product Care for Vinyl Flooring

Vinyl looks great in your home, but as a bonus, it’s also incredibly easy to maintain. With just a touch of infrequent cleaning, you’ll be enjoying stylish floors with minimal effort.

Read our tips below to keep your floors beautiful.

BASIC MAINTENANCE TIPS

  • Sweep, dust and vacuum your floors (without the beater brush) at least once a week to keep them free of dirt and dust build-up.
  • A water-damp mop or cloth once a week, or a mop and a spray bottle of hot water, will keep your floors gleaming.
  • Be careful that any liquid cleaning products are approved for vinyl before applying.
  • Clean up any spills as soon as possible.
  • Avoid scrubbing with abrasive cleaners or scrubbing agents.
  • Read manufacturer guidelines before using steam-cleaning machines. Some steam cleaners may get too hot to be safe for your floor.

STAIN REMOVAL

  • Clean up wet spills as soon as they happen.
  • Wipe stains and spills with a warm, damp cloth. Do not scrub with a harsh surface.
  • For stubborn stains, use a vinyl-specific or gentle all-purpose cleaner. Vinegar is also safe for your floors and helps with stickier spills.
  • To remove pen ink, permanent marker, or nail polish, apply isopropyl alcohol.
